The wireless connection between the IP security
camera and the router is not working.
1. Check the wireless settings and in particular the entered
code. All WLAN channels may not be enabled. Adjust the
“Region” setting when entering the Wireless settings.
2. You router may allocate changing local IP addresses each
time it connects. Search for the IP security camera again
using supra IPCam Config.
IP security camera can be reached locally but not
through the Internet.
This generally always occurs when Port forwarding is not or is
incorrectly set up in the router.

Internet connection via 3G/4G mobile phone
networks.
In case of an Internet connection via a 3G/4G mobile phone
network, no public IP address may be allocated to your In-
ternet access. In this case you have to apply to your Internet
provider to provide you with a public IP address.
Also, the option “Open Internet” must be activated with the
Internet provider “Drei.at“.
Access via the public address is not possible from your
own network.
Generally it is not possible to call up the IP security camera
via the Internet from the same network the camera is connec-
ted to. This can only be done using the local network address.
